Top Home Upgrades That Boost Value Before You Sell

Selling your home is all about first impressions and return on investment. The right upgrades can significantly boost your home’s value, helping it sell faster and at a higher price—without overspending. Here are the top home upgrades that consistently deliver strong returns before you put your property on the market.

1. Fresh Paint for Instant Appeal
A fresh coat of neutral paint is one of the most cost-effective upgrades you can make. Light, neutral colors help buyers envision themselves in the space and make rooms feel larger, brighter, and cleaner.

2. Kitchen Updates That Matter
You don’t need a full kitchen remodel to add value. Simple upgrades like new cabinet hardware, updated light fixtures, modern faucets, or resurfaced countertops can make a big impact. Clean, updated kitchens are a major selling point for buyers.

3. Bathroom Improvements
Bathrooms sell homes. Replace outdated vanities, mirrors, and lighting, and re-grout or re-tile if needed. Even small changes can make bathrooms feel more modern and spa-like, increasing buyer appeal.

4. Boost Curb Appeal
First impressions start outside. Fresh landscaping, trimmed hedges, new mulch, and a clean walkway instantly enhance curb appeal. Consider painting the front door or updating exterior lighting to make your home more inviting.

5. Flooring Upgrades
Worn carpets or dated flooring can turn buyers away. Replacing old carpet with laminate, vinyl plank, or refinished hardwood floors can dramatically increase perceived value and durability.

6. Energy-Efficient Features
Buyers love energy savings. Upgrades like smart thermostats, LED lighting, and energy-efficient windows or appliances can make your home more attractive while signaling lower utility costs.

By focusing on strategic, high-impact upgrades, you can maximize your home’s value and stand out in a competitive market. Smart improvements today can lead to a smoother, more profitable sale tomorrow.
